- 01 Spiral Pour byBlue Bottle Coffee Blue Bottle's Chemex recipe scaled for the 3-cup. Spiral pour at 10g/s from center outward. Blue Bottle recommends slightly finer grind for smaller batches. Chemex 3 Cup Ratio 1:16 Time 3:30
- 02 Flash Iced byChemex Flash brew iced coffee for the 3-cup Chemex. Brew hot directly over ice for instant cooling. Chemex 3 Cup Ratio 1:10 Time 2:30
- 03 Light Roast 3-Cup byChemex Chemex 3-cup recipe optimized for light roast coffees. Higher temperature and slightly finer grind extract more from hard-to-extract light roasts. The thick Chemex filter produces a tea-like clarity. Chemex 3 Cup Ratio 1:15.9 Time 3:30
- 04 Nordic Light 3-Cup byChemex High extraction Nordic style on the small Chemex. Bright, sweet, and juicy from light roasts. Chemex 3 Cup Ratio 1:16.7 Time 3:30
- 05 Single Pour byChemex Minimal intervention method for the 3-cup Chemex. One continuous pour after bloom. Chemex 3 Cup Ratio 1:15.6 Time 2:30
- 06 High Extraction byOrea The MK2's improved bed geometry allows for finer grinds and higher extraction. Orea V3 MK2 Ratio 1:16.7 Time 3:30
- 07 Flash Iced byOrea Flash brew iced coffee optimized for the MK2. The 32 teeth design handles fine grind with ice brew perfectly. Orea V3 MK2 Ratio 1:8.9 Time 2:00
- 08 Iced byOrea Flash iced coffee on the Orea V3 Mk2. Orea V3 MK2 Ratio 1:10 Time 2:30
- 09 Light Roast byOrea Orea V3 MK2 recipe for light roasts. Finer grind and hotter water. Orea V3 MK2 Ratio 1:16.7 Time 3:00
- 10 The Wide byOrea High extraction recipe with fine grind and flat paper filter. The MK2's teeth prevent clogging even at this fine grind. Orea V3 MK2 Ratio 1:20 Time 3:30
- 11 Competition Siphon Championship-style siphon (vacuum pot) recipe. Precise temperature control with stirring technique for a remarkably clean, aromatic cup. The theatrical brewing method produces some of the clearest coffee possible. Japanese Siphon Ratio 1:15 Time 3:30
- 12 Cross Stir byEspresso Workshop Espresso Workshop NZ siphon recipe. Double-stir technique with a cross-pattern stir for even extraction. Japanese Siphon Ratio 1:15.3 Time 2:10
- 13 High Extraction — Two-Stir byJonathan Gagné Coffee ad Astra's high extraction siphon recipe. Finer grind and vigorous agitation for maximum sweetness. Japanese Siphon Ratio 1:15.2 Time 2:15
- 14 High Extraction — Turkish-Fine byJonathan Gagné Ultra-fine grind siphon recipe by Jonathan Gagne (Coffee ad Astra). Extremely fine grind yields 23-24% extraction with a short steep time. Japanese Siphon Ratio 1:16.7 Time 2:30
- 15 Iced Siphon Flash-brewed iced siphon coffee. Higher dose brewed at double strength, then poured over ice. The siphon's clean extraction combined with rapid cooling produces a bright, aromatic iced coffee. Japanese Siphon Ratio 1:10 Time 3:10
